Another trip to Trebinje: Basketball camp 2011

Monday 01 August 2011

This summer the Greenhouse basketball players found themselves back in Bosnia to take part in Dejan Bodiroga’s 2011 ‘Get better this summer’ Basketball Camp.

Coaches from; Harris Academy, South Norwood, Stockwell Park High School, Bacon’s College, Norwood School, Knights and Pimlico Academies (who are all currently part of the Greenhouse programmes) escorted a number of young basketball stars abroad to embark on an intensive training programme.  They met players from other countries at the camp which was held in a small town called Trebenje in Bosnia & Herzegovina, where the institution was established more than 10 years ago. Here the players mixed, shared knowledge about their various skills and experiences in the game and learnt about each others’ cultures.

Dean from Harris Academy explains: “The camp has been one of the greatest basketball experiences I have ever witnessed and took part in. The people are friendly, the coaches are very co-operative, the food is amazing and the training is intense, you will get a lot out of it...”

Across the three week camp, around 60 Greenhouse participants took part. It was a unique opportunity for the young people to develop their physical and mental attitudes as well as meet new friends and add to their travel experiences.

“The camp exceeded my expectations by far, it gave everything it promised. The coaches were brilliant and helpful with their first priority being to help you develop and mature into a better basketball player. It also helped me to develop social skills which in turn led to us making new friends.  My first time but certainly not my last...” says Darington from Bacon’s College.

A special thanks to the camp facilitators  Professor Dr. Milivoje Karalejic, Dragan, and all the international coaches as well as the Greenhouse Coaches who helped to make the event a success and a memorable experience for all involved.

"One of the best moments during the camp is the evening competitions which include two point and three point shooting competitions and five on five games. When the crowd is watching, it makes you feel like you’re a top NBA player.” Diniro from Norwood School.
